Many people in Northwest Washington learn about talc-related concerns through news coverage and public health discussions. But a claim in Burlington isn’t built on headlines—it’s built on a documented connection between:

  • the products you used (brand, type, and time frame)
  • the medical condition you were diagnosed with
  • the medical evidence that supports a causation theory

Your attorney can help you organize the timeline while your doctors handle treatment. That matters because product-injury cases depend on consistency: what you used, when you used it, and how your condition was evaluated.

In Washington, civil claims can be affected by statutory deadlines (including how long you have to file and when certain notice requirements apply). In addition to legal timing, there’s another deadline that often matters just as much: evidence availability.

Over time, Burlington residents may lose access to:

  • old purchase records
  • medical records from earlier providers
  • product containers stored in garages, closets, or nursing-home settings
  • witness recollections

Your attorney can help preserve what’s most important—then build a case around it—so you’re not forced to rely on memory alone.

Instead of treating the claim like a general complaint, your lawyer will focus on evidence that answers the hard questions. Typically, that means:

  • Exposure: identifying the talc-containing products and the duration and frequency of use
  • Diagnosis: obtaining medical records, pathology/testing results where applicable, and treatment summaries
  • Causation support: working with qualified medical and technical professionals to address how clinicians connect exposure to your condition

Your legal team can also evaluate how the product was marketed and what warnings or labeling existed during the time you used it.

If you’ve been harmed, you may wonder what “filing” actually involves. In Washington, the process typically includes:

  1. Case intake and documentation: pulling your medical history and product details into a usable timeline
  2. Identifying responsible parties: determining which companies may be tied to the product’s design, manufacturing, distribution, or branding
  3. Drafting and filing: preparing the complaint and supporting information required to start the lawsuit
  4. Discovery and record requests: obtaining additional documents and technical materials
  5. Settlement discussions or litigation: resolving through negotiations when possible, or preparing for court if needed

Because product-liability cases can involve complex records, having a lawyer who’s used to handling document-heavy disputes can reduce confusion and delays.

Every case is different, but compensation in talc-related product injury matters may include:

  • medical bills (past and future)
  • treatment-related costs and related care
  • lost income or reduced earning capacity
  • non-economic damages such as pain, suffering, and loss of enjoyment of life

Your attorney will explain which categories appear most supported based on your diagnosis, treatment path, and work situation.

If you’re considering a talcum powder claim in Burlington, Washington, these are practical next moves:

  • Schedule or continue medical care and keep all appointment notes and test results organized
  • Document your product history: brands, approximate purchase dates, where you bought the product, and how often it was used
  • Collect what you have: photos of labels, containers, receipts, or even old packaging
  • Write a short timeline while details are fresh—how your routine changed and when symptoms began

Avoid guessing about causation based solely on online claims. A lawyer can help you separate what’s relevant from what’s just noise.
